Substrate and surface prep, the unglamorous backbone

Paint fails ordinarilly because it won't snatch what's below. Concrete dusts, metals rust, and antique coatings cling mystery infection. The prep plan should still match the substrate.

Concrete flooring: For uncooked or worn concrete, you prefer a sparkling, profiled surface. Shot blasting is the workhorse, generating a uniform texture and casting off vulnerable cream. Depending on the formula, an ICRI CSP profile of three to 5 is regularly occurring. Acid etching still exhibits up in small shops, but it really is inconsistent, introduces moisture, and can go away salts. Diamond grinding is a easy selection for occupied centers where filth control is tight, regardless that this is slower. Moisture is the silent killer; if the slab is interpreting upper than about 75 to eighty five % relative humidity with the aid of in-situ probes, determine a moisture-tolerant primer or mitigation gadget, or you possibly can get osmotic blistering.

Masonry partitions: CMU and tilt-up panels hold efflorescence, patchwork from historical anchors, and hairline cracks. Power washing with precise reclaim, followed via spot grinding and patching, gets you to sound substrate. Alkalinity matters, surprisingly on new tilt-up, so an alkali-resistant licensed mbk painting company primer isn't very overkill, it's insurance.

Steel accessories: Columns, mezzanine stringers, bollards, and handrails need rust remediation that matches the severity. For surface rust, you would routinely prep to SSPC-SP3, then most advantageous with a rust-inhibitive primer. For heavier corrosion, abrasive blasting to close to white (SP10) should be warranted. Where blasting is unimaginable, a floor-tolerant epoxy can bridge the space, yet in simple terms if loose rust is if truth be told removed.

Prep isn't very simply mechanical. Degreasing is probably the breakpoint among good fortune and failure, significantly in nutrients and beverage plants and automobile warehouses. A quickly move with a detergent mop shouldn't be adequate. You experiment water break free surfaces, you chase corners with scrub pads, you rinse and dry fully. A terrific team can odor silicone contamination prior to they see it. They will tell you if your coatings will fisheye.

Coating families and in which they shine

There are no magic items that do the whole thing. There are families of coatings that, while paired, cowl maximum commercial wants.

Epoxy methods: The Swiss Army knife of commercial painting. High solids epoxies build movie, resist chemical compounds, and bond like they mean it. They shine on flooring, structural steel, and block partitions. Their weakness is UV yellowing and chalking, so for sunlit parts, you topcoat with urethane. Epoxies are available in many flavors. a hundred percentage solids versions are brilliant for thick builds and coffee VOC zones, but they're ordinarily greater touchy to moisture and require cautious mixing and time leadership. Water-based epoxies are more easy in occupied spaces by way of lower smell and faster recoat windows, yet they'll not take the identical punishment as a heavy-construct solvent-loose technique.

Polyurethane and polyaspartic topcoats: These deliver abrasion resistance, coloration and gloss retention, and faster return to service. On a picking out line that runs 20 hours an afternoon, being able to recoat at the 4 to 6 hour mark other than overnight will also be the big difference between a convinced and a no from operations. Polyaspartics treatment in the chilly more advantageous than many coatings and do neatly on mezzanine decks and stair treads that see steady foot site visitors.

Acrylics and elastomerics: For top partitions and ceilings, acrylic industrial enamels offer you cleanability and pale leap with no heavy odor. On tilt-up with hairline flow, elastomeric coatings can bridge microcracks. They will not be for every wall, and they're able to seize moisture if the building wishes to breathe, so the painter may still cost vapor force and detail weeps.

Moisture mitigation primers: If you take a look at a slab and it is breathing complicated, a moisture vapor emission handle primer can shop a floor manner. Think of those as traffic police officers that reduce down vapor transmission so your epoxy stays flat and tight. They upload money, but they're inexpensive than delamination and transform.

High-temperature and strong point coatings: Near ovens, boilers, or warm washers, silicone alkyds or excessive-temp silicones preserve coloration and film wherein frequent paints fail. In chemical task spaces, novolac epoxies push chemical resistance into the good acid and solvent territory. They are harder to use and regularly come with narrower pot lives. An experienced team earns its hold here.

Floors lift the weight, literally

Floors are wherein operations meet coatings, and the place maximum court cases dwell. The specification ought to replicate site visitors styles. Identify force aisles, static rack rows, staging regions, and turning elements. Where wheels flip and load transfers, use thicker builds and tougher topcoats. Where individuals walk and mop, a lighter manner is superb.

The step that saves floors is in most cases the joint aspect. A brittle coating that spans a moving observed reduce will crack. A flexible polyurea joint filler, shaved flush, affords the epoxy a point transition and protects wheels. In the Columbus mission, shaving joint filler ahead of coating lower forklift chatter and tire losing substantially, which saved the topcoat purifier and lowered black marks.

Slip resistance is a balancing act. Too much texture and cleaning becomes a battle. Too little and a gentle oil movie turns treacherous. We traditionally broadcast 20 to 40 mesh aluminum oxide flippantly into the first topcoat in moist zones, then seal it with a 2d coat to bury sharp edges. In components with constant sweeping or ground scrubbers, we switch to a rounded polymer bead mixture. It is kinder to squeegees and scrubbing pads.

Color is extra than aesthetics. Medium grey on floors hides scuffs greater than darkish grey, which presentations each filth track. Safety yellow that fits ANSI Z535 assistance helps to keep visual language constant. For aisles, we push for wider lines than you suspect you desire, ordinarilly 6 to eight inches, with boxed intersections to withstand chipping from turns. If the funds allows, a complete method on linework, now not just a single coat, buys longer life.

Walls and ceilings do quiet work

Many services dwell with dingy partitions because they imagine cleanliness best belongs on floors and kit. A vivid, washable wall method will pay again in lighting and compliance. If you've gotten skylights, bear in mind the UV exposure, if you want to yellow everyday epoxies. Acrylic or polyurethane topcoats carry coloration and would be cleaned with no chalking.

On CMU, filling the pores is half the combat. One tight coat of block filler adopted through two conclude coats presents you a wipeable floor that does not harbor grime. At eight to ten ft up, upload a semi-gloss band round corners and high-impression zones. Pallets will nevertheless kiss the wall, however the scuffs wipe off. We have retrofitted many loading components like this and cut repaint touch-up by means of half of.

Ceilings in manufacturing spaces assemble airborne oil and dust. A dryfall acrylic sprayed onto open metal, ductwork, and decking saves cleanup time. The overspray dries to airborne dirt and dust prior to hitting the ground, so it vacuums up in place of clinging. It shouldn't be a for all time conclude, however it renews the room, reflects mild, and allows upkeep crew spot leaks on fresh white surfaces.

Corrosion, the sluggish thief

In coastal warehouses or amenities that manage fertilizers, salts creep in and pace corrosion. Even inland, condensation on bloodless steel or day by day washdowns invite rust. A reasonable plan mixes inspection, distinct blasting, and wise primers. On a steel mezzanine that have been spot-primed 3 times in five years, we switched the store to a floor-tolerant epoxy mastic after force software cleaning to SP11. The recoat period widened to a few years, then 4. The gain got here no longer from a posh product, yet from matching the paint to the genuine prep we may want to do between shifts.

Where you'll, isolate metal from traffic and moisture. Poly caps on base plates and a small reduce at column bases lower splashback. It is a pale civil detail that saves gallons of paint later.

Scheduling, shutdowns, and sincere math

Operational fact shapes painter options. Coatings come residential mbk painting with remedy home windows. Some epoxies choose 8 to twelve hours beforehand mild foot traffic, 24 to forty eight hours previously heavy hundreds. Polyaspartics can reduce that with the aid of 1/2 or greater, but they check greater in keeping with gallon and may well be unforgiving in humidity. The desirable plan weighs cloth expense towards downtime, threat, and labor.

Night shifts and weekends are wide-spread for occupied warehouses. You divide the space into zones, cordon off with clean signage, and level curing zones so air go with the flow facilitates, not hinders. HVAC becomes element of the crew. Negative air in one corner can drag solvent odor throughout a determining line whenever you do not plan it. In a cuisine-grade facility, smell manipulate and 0-VOC methods might possibly be vital, which’ll push you in the direction of waterborne epoxies and acrylics notwithstanding their scale down film construct.

Cure and recoat home windows aren't assistance. On a iciness activity in Minnesota, a crew attempted to cheat a urethane topcoat onto an epoxy base at the low cease of the recoat window, with the slab at forty five stages Fahrenheit. The effect become amine blush and a dull, powdery film. We needed to degloss, wash with hot water and detergent, and recoat on the properly temp. Lesson paid for twice.

Safety and compliance are living within the details

Industrial portray sits at the crossroads of OSHA, EPA, fire codes, and in some cases USDA or FDA expectations. A tidy jobsite is a trustworthy one. Good crews cable-maintain their sprayers, avoid rolling gear out of aisles, and never go away an unattended wet paint risk in a trail of travel. For flammable coatings, grounding and bonding are non-negotiable. Ventilation plans needs to be written and shared. Where confined spaces are portion of the scope, access allows for and screens are the baseline, no longer the deluxe package deal.

Hazard conversation continues after the task. Leave preservation with the full data: product names, batch numbers, colorations and sheens, recoat windows, and contact-up classes. In a plant that runs lean, that binder earns its shelf area.

Cleaning, upkeep, and while to assert “now not but”

A new coating approach does now not absolve you of cleaning. In actuality, the quickest approach to shorten a floor’s life is to permit grit act like sandpaper under wheels. A walk-at the back of auto scrubber with comfortable pads, neutral cleaner, and commonplace passes does more well than any contact-up paint. Solvents have a spot, however a heavy-passed degreaser will boring a urethane rapid.

Maintenance cycles are extra art than technological know-how. In widespread, contact up high-put on edges and linework every year, deep clean quarterly, and stroll the space per month with a upkeep lead. Document chips and blisters. Early repair beats patchwork. If you see conventional adhesion failure, discontinue. Throwing extra paint at a unhealthy bond is cost into the wind. Pull tests, moisture checks, and a scope reset is perhaps imperative until now you preserve.

Sometimes the true call is to attend. If the slab continues to be curing off moisture at a top rate, grasp off on a heavy epoxy process and run with a breathable sealer for 6 months. If the customer is ready to reconfigure racking, pin down the hot aisle locations ahead of you paint traces. Painters earn agree with through pronouncing “now not but” as in most cases as they are saying definite.

Real-world snapshots that taught lessons

A bottling plant requested for a fast floor refresh in a syrup room. The present epoxy regarded intact, however the gloss was once choppy. The moisture readings have been borderline, 85 to ninety percent. The assignment manager wished to proceed with a general epoxy recoat. We pressed for a moisture-tolerant primer and a slip-resistant urethane topcoat. Two months later, a line leaked, and the syrup puddled. The slip resistance kept feet underneath our bodies, and the primer avoided osmotic blisters. The repair became a small patch, no longer a complete regrind.

In a chilly garage dock, crews battled condensation close the seals each and every morning. Walls peeled yearly. The fix become now not a “enhanced paint” yet a series: vitality wash on the finish of 2nd shift, run dehumidifiers and specified heaters overnight, install a penetrating sealer at the concrete block to slow vapor drive, then practice an alkali-resistant epoxy primer and a polyurethane end. We also further a small air curtain at the worst door. Three winters later, the partitions still cleaned up with a mop.

On a mezzanine catwalk with consistent foot traffic, the initial plan used to be a basic alkyd tooth. It may have appeared substantive for a month and then chalked and scuffed. We pivoted to a waterborne epoxy for low scent, then a two-issue waterborne urethane for abrasion resistance. Return to carrier changed into the following morning at 6 a.m., and the odor stayed inside relief limits due to the fact that the HVAC turned into staged in fact. Operations barely noticed we were there.
